Psalm 107 is a rich and deeply reflective chapter that highlights God’s steadfast love and faithfulness, especially towards those who call out to Him in times of distress. It portrays a recurring cycle of human struggles, divine deliverance, and grateful response, making it a beautiful testimony of God’s mercy.

Here are some significant themes and observations:

  1. The Call to Give Thanks: The psalm begins with an exhortation to thank God for His goodness and unfailing love (verse 1). It’s a reminder that gratitude is central to faith.
  2. Stories of Deliverance: The psalm recounts various scenarios where people faced overwhelming difficulties—wandering in deserts, imprisonment, illness, and storms at sea. In each case, they cried out to the Lord, and He rescued them. These vivid examples emphasize God’s ability to intervene in every kind of crisis.
  3. God’s Sovereignty: The psalm underscores how God controls nature, humbles the proud, and exalts the humble. For instance, He calms the storm and provides food to the hungry. This demonstrates His power and care for His creation.
  4. A Call to Reflection: The chapter concludes by urging the wise to take these truths to heart and consider God’s unfailing love (verse 43). It challenges readers to meditate on God’s actions and to recognize His hand in their lives.

Psalm 107 is often seen as a testimony of redemption and a reminder that God hears the cries of those in need. Its poetic structure, with repeated refrains like “Then they cried to the Lord in their trouble, and He delivered them from their distress,” invites personal reflection and worship.
